The Role of Cognitive Biases
Cognitive biases play a significant role in the decision-making processes of gamblers. One common bias is the “illusion of control,” where individuals believe they can influence outcomes through skill or strategy, even in inherently random games. This misconception can lead to repeated gambling, as players chase losses, believing that their next bet will yield a favorable result.
Another relevant cognitive bias is the “gambler’s fallacy,” which is the belief that past events can influence future outcomes in games of chance. For instance, someone might think that because a particular slot machine hasn’t paid out recently, it is “due” for a win. These biases not only shape gambling behavior but also perpetuate a cycle of risk-taking that can be difficult to break.
Emotional Triggers and Gambling
Emotions play a crucial role in gambling behavior. Many individuals gamble to escape from stress, anxiety, or boredom, seeking the adrenaline rush that comes from the chance of winning. This emotional connection can make it challenging for players to recognize when their gambling has become problematic. In environments like Sweepstakes Casinos, the stimulation of winning can lead to a temporary boost in mood, reinforcing the desire to return and gamble again.
On the flip side, losing can trigger negative emotions such as frustration or despair. These feelings can drive individuals to gamble even more in an attempt to recover their losses, creating a dangerous cycle of emotional highs and lows. Understanding these emotional triggers is vital for anyone looking to engage with gambling in a healthy way, especially for beginners.
Strategies for Responsible Gambling
To ensure a positive gambling experience, it is essential to adopt strategies that promote responsible behavior. Setting strict budgets can help individuals manage their finances and prevent excessive losses. Players should establish limits on the amount of time and money they spend at the casino, treating gambling as a form of entertainment rather than a reliable source of income.
Additionally, awareness of one’s emotional state is crucial. Players should regularly assess their motivations for gambling and recognize when their behavior may be veering into problematic territory. Implementing breaks during gambling sessions can also provide valuable moments for reflection and self-assessment, helping to maintain a healthy relationship with gambling.
